Magnet.me  -  The smart network where students and professionals find their internship or job.

The smart network where students and professionals find their internship or job.

Software Product Assurance Engineer

Posted 12 May 2026
Share:
Work experience
5 to 8 years
Full-time / part-time
Full-time
Job function
Degree level
Required languages
English (Fluent)
French (Fluent)
Deadline
1 June 2026

Build your career on Magnet.me

Create a profile and receive smart job recommendations based on your liked jobs.

This is a fixed-term appointment with an initial duration of 4 years. Depending upon performance and organisational needs, the appointment may be extended up to a possible maximum duration of 8 years.

Description

You will be assigned as Software Product Assurance Engineer in the Software Product Assurance (PA) Section, Quality and Product Assurance Management Division, Quality Department, Directorate of Technology, Engineering and Quality.

The Section provides functional support to ESA projects and is responsible for the development, implementation and maintenance of software product assurance expertise and standards. It carries out technological research (R&D) in software PA requirements, techniques, methodologies and tools. It also collaborates on standardisation and training activities.

Duties

Reporting to the Head of Section, your main tasks and responsibilities will include:

  • Providing expert technical support and consultancy to ESA projects, including involvement in projects’ major reviews and, where applicable, boards and panels.
  • Supporting projects in monitoring contractor software product assurance programme execution to ensure compliance with software product assurance requirements.
  • Preparing and implementing general programmatic and technical software product assurance requirements aligned with Agency standards and specifications.
  • Establishing project-specific programmatic and technical software product assurance requirements based on the ESA product assurance baseline.
  • Supporting projects in evaluating contractor documentation and efforts proposed for the execution of software product assurance programmes.
  • Evaluating proposed concepts, designs and operations for compliance with defined software product assurance requirements, including the performance of associated audits.
  • Defining, initiating and managing R&D activities relating to software product assurance requirements, techniques, methodologies and tools, covering long- and short-term needs.
  • Supporting and, at the request of line management, participating in the Directorate’s R&D activities.
  • Auditing contractors and their in-house standards for compliance with ESA requirements, assessing the maturity of their software processes.
  • Liaising with related engineering and PA specialists regarding overlapping areas of activity.
  • Monitoring applicable scientific and technological trends and maintaining state-of-the-art expertise.

Technical competencies

  • Understanding of related technologies and R&D trends and familiarity with the industrial landscape.
  • Project support experience in a relevant domain.
  • Experience with the application of software product assurance and ASIC/FPGA product assurance requirements, tools and methods.
  • Experience in the management and monitoring of industrial activities, including participation in reviews.
  • Experience with Space Quality Standards and their preparation and implementation.

Behavioural competencies

  • Result Orientation
  • Operational Efficiency
  • Fostering Cooperation
  • Relationship Management
  • Continuous Improvement
  • Forward Thinking

Education and professional experience

A master’s degree in computer science, software engineering or a similar discipline is required for this post, together with five years of relevant professional experience.

Additional requirements

Experience in at least three of the following areas:

  • Software product assurance in critical real-time applications.
  • Software engineering.
  • Software configuration management.
  • Dependability assessment of software-intensive systems.
  • Software development and maintenance.
  • Software process assessment and auditing.

Some knowledge in the following areas will be considered an asset:

  • Agile practices.
  • Quality assurance for machine learning models.
  • Big data software architectures and life cycles.
  • Data quality assurance.
  • Software verification and validation.
  • ASIC/FPGA product assurance.
  • Cyber security assurance.
  • Hands-on experience of static code analysis and tools.
  • Alternative software development life cycles, continuous integration and tools.

Important Information and Disclaimer

In principle, recruitment will be within the advertised grade band (A2-A4). However, if the selected candidate has less than four years of relevant professional experience following the completion of the master’s degree, the position may be filled at A1 level.

Applicants must be eligible to access information, technology, and hardware subject to European or US export control and sanctions regulations and eligible to acquire the security clearance by their national security administrations.

Note that ESA is in the process of transitioning to a Matrix setup, which could lead to organisational changes affecting this position.

Nationality and Languages

Please note that applications are only considered from nationals of one of the following States: Austria, Belgium, Czechia, Denmark, Estonia, Finland, France, Germany, Greece, Hungary, Ireland, Italy, Luxembourg, the Netherlands, Norway, Poland, Portugal, Romania, Slovenia, Spain, Sweden, Switzerland, the United Kingdom, Canada, Cyprus, Latvia, Lithuania and Slovakia.

The working languages of the Agency are English and French. A good knowledge of one of these is required. Knowledge of another Member State language would be an asset.

The European Space Agency (ESA) is Europe’s gateway to space. Its mission is to shape the development of Europe’s space capability and ensure that investment in space continues to deliver benefits to the citizens of Europe and the world.

Aerospace & Defence
Noordwijk
4,000 employees